The Impact of Untreated Water on Brewery Equipment

Untreated water can introduce minerals and contaminants that may corrode equipment, clog lines, and negatively influence yeast health. Over time, these factors can lead to increased operational costs due to equipment repairs, unplanned downtime, and the need for more frequent replacement of components like filters and pumps. Moreover, the brewing process itself may be affected, leading to variations in batch quality and potentially affecting consumer satisfaction.

Understanding Demand: Peak vs. Average Usage

Breweries experience fluctuations in water demand, with peak usage often occurring during production cycles. Understanding the difference between peak and average demand is critical when sizing a water treatment system. Systems must be capable of handling peak demands to prevent any bottlenecks in production. An improperly sized system could lead to insufficient flow during busy times, resulting in costly delays.

Duty Cycle and Sizing Considerations

The duty cycle of your brewery refers to the operational period required for your processes. This will significantly influence the required size of the system built for your water treatment needs. To accurately assess capacity, consider:

  • Flow Rate (GPM): The gallons per minute necessary to meet production demands during peak times.
  • Capacity (Grains/GPD): The total grains of hardness and contaminants the system can handle daily, ensuring that water remains within optimal quality parameters.

Redundancy in Systems: Ensuring Continuous Operation

Redundancy is an essential factor for commercial brewery water systems. Implementing duplex or alternating configurations can ensure that if one unit is in maintenance or undergoing service, the other can carry the load without impacting production. This level of reliability is crucial for maintaining a steady workflow, particularly in a business where every batch counts.

Pretreatment Requirements

Before investing in a water treatment system, it is essential to consider any pretreatment requirements. Depending on the source water quality, additional systems like sediment filters or carbon units may be necessary to precondition the water before it enters the main treatment system. Analyzing the source water profile will help determine the best configuration for your facility.

Maintenance and Consumable Considerations

Just like any piece of machinery, water treatment systems require regular maintenance to operate efficiently. It’s important to establish clear intervals for filter changes, membrane cleaning, and other consumable replacements. Oversight in these areas can lead to a decline in system performance and an increase in downtime.

Space and Drain Requirements

Space considerations in a brewery are often at a premium. Ensure that the chosen water treatment system fits within the operational layout without obstructing workflows. Additionally, proper drainage must be accounted for, as many systems will require a specific drainage setup to handle backflush waste and other byproducts of water treatment.

Impact on Flavor Profile

The water chemistry plays a crucial role in the flavor profile of beer. Different minerals contribute various characteristics to the final product, influencing taste, mouthfeel, and aroma. For instance, the presence of calcium can enhance the perception of bitterness, while magnesium may contribute to the overall complexity of flavors. Understanding these impacts helps brewers manipulate water composition to achieve desired outcomes.

Choosing the Right Treatment Technology

Various treatment technologies exist, each suited for different challenges. Reverse osmosis, for example, is highly effective for removing dissolved solids, while ultraviolet disinfection can eliminate harmful microorganisms without chemicals. Understanding the strengths and limitations of each technology allows breweries to tailor their approach and effectively address their specific water quality issues.
